Denver City Council scheduled a second reading and public hearing on the proposed data center moratorium for May 18 with an anticipated effective date of May 21 if it passes. The pause would block all new zoning permits and site development plans for data centers for up to one year while the city drafts regulations on energy use, water consumption, noise, and placement. Co-sponsored by Councilmembers Darrell Watson and Paul Kashmann. Driver: a community meeting Feb 24 in Elyria-Swansea over a large in-construction data center near homes; residents argued permitting bypassed adequate community notification. Colorado state-level data center bills are stalled in the legislature.

Why it matters
Denver is a small data center market, but it's the first major U.S. metro to consider a city-wide moratorium that blocks all new entitlement processing rather than just zoning approval. The procedural nuance matters for Cliff's submission-validator product: a moratorium that blocks 'acceptance, processing or approval' freezes filings at the intake step, which means the data center developer can't even compile a complete record while the moratorium is in effect. That's a different surface than an after-the-fact zoning rejection (which leaves the record buildable) and it changes the site readiness timeline math materially. Pair with Denver's separate effort to reduce city-wide water use 20%; the data center water/cooling angle is now a primary moratorium driver in arid-climate metros and feeds directly into the air-permit case study scope (cooling-tower drift, water-temperature effluent in some jurisdictions ladders into Title V applicability).
